Output 31f3e8fa6c9da9a80ba977e428da63eea17b149c88d1dcbf9a0ce306dc591b39:0

value
215765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c95e2af6153fbe94eb600526a2a0c1176906a1 OP_EQUAL
address
3MMzS52nMQXnLNFxAqKxV46jgLA6isCuM2
transaction
31f3e8fa6c9da9a80ba977e428da63eea17b149c88d1dcbf9a0ce306dc591b39
spent
true